What voltage do solar batteries need?
Understanding Battery Voltage: Knowing the correct voltage for solar batteries is essential for optimizing the performance and efficiency of your solar energy system. Common Voltage Options: Solar batteries typically come in three common voltages: 12V (for small systems), 24V (for mid-sized systems), and 48V (for larger installations).

What volts should a battery be?
Smaller batteries typically have lower voltages, such as 12 volts, which suit compact systems or applications like RVs and boats. Larger systems require higher voltages; for example, 24-volt batteries best suit moderate setups, providing a good balance between size and energy storage.

Are 48 volt solar batteries good?
48-volt batteries offer superior efficiency for larger systems, featuring reduced current levels, enhanced scalability, and longer lifespans.
